Hi,

I'd like to load the latest EPG upgrade onto my Sky+ V2 box to allow me to use the red dot timeout facility, but I've tried a couple of forced updates, and it keeps doesn't upgrade.

I'm using the power down, then power up holding the backup button on the front of the unit, until the software upgrade message appears. The unit resets after about 10 minutes.

I then power it up with the Sky button on the remote, and it's still on the old version of the software.

Should I leave the box in standby for a bit longer after the forced upgrade?

I don't have an activated card in the box at the time of the upgrade, could this be the reason?
